From Fox News:

Kid Rock, who has been tossing around the idea of a U.S. Senate run since July, fired back in his own colorful way Friday against a Washington-based watchdog group that claimed he was in violation of campaign finance law.

“Go f— yourself,” the rocker said.

The watchdog group, Common Cause, filed a complaint with U.S. Department of Justice and the Federal Election Commission, arguing that the singer, whose real name is Robert Ritchie, is an official candidate because he has been selling “Kid Rock for Senate” merchandise and teasing the idea of a Senate run for months.

But they say he’s still breaking the law.

“Regardless of whether Kid Rock says he’s only exploring candidacy, he’s selling ‘Kid Rock for Senate’ merchandise and is a candidate under the law. This is campaign finance law 101,” Paul Seamus Ryan, vice president for policy and litigation at the watchdog group, told the Hill.
